Transaction 64fc14ec2a7a8e626683c842755c5fae69ce064e9fa189cf54706fb6ddfee217

5 Input
2 Outputs
  • 64fc14ec2a7a8e626683c842755c5fae69ce064e9fa189cf54706fb6ddfee217:0
  • value  256244
    address  125DV17ACrRKyu9GinEFaVzDv8aB8h4xyR
  • 64fc14ec2a7a8e626683c842755c5fae69ce064e9fa189cf54706fb6ddfee217:1
  • value  2100000
    address  3Km4LjN6HzoSWxU1nGArhP1yQJgWUAvbnq